keither Posted February 7, 2006 Report Share Posted February 7, 2006 Hey all.Just a little reminder about this Saturday night's excursion into the musical world of jamtronica... in the spirit of bands like STS9, Particle, Disco Biscuits, Lotus, Signal Path & The Pnuma Trio... to name a few.Sure to be an amazing night of music and dancing... come join us for some good times!!NAMEDROPPER w. guests SPACE 9Saturday February 11thThe Fairview Pub898 West BroadwayDoors at 9:00 - Show starts at 10:00 sharp$7.00 admissionNAMEDROPPERFeaturing Brad Turner on keys (Metalwood, Soulstream), Russ Klyne on guitar (K-OS), Ray Garraway on drums (K-OS) and new addition Sean Drabitt on bass.Namedropper are a highly skilled, instrumental fusion based band who incorporate elements of dub, ambient, drum & bass and breakbeats with amazing jam sensibilities. Having recently performed on both Roger's Community Television's 'Urban Rush' and CBC's 'ZedTV', NAMEDROPPER continue to make an indelible mark on Vancouver's groove music scene.SPACE 9Featuring Laurence Santos on keys, Mark Campbell on bass, Nathan Wylie on drums, Brad Shipley on guitar and Michael Lowe on Turntables.Formed in the summer of 2003, this Vancouver based urban groove quintet combines the styles of jazz, funk, electronica, drum & bass, trip-hop and dub reggae. Extended improvisation and ambient textures are combined with rythmic concepts from Africa, Afro-Cuban and Indian styles to create a ‘tripped out-down to earth’ contemporary sound. Influences include Herbie Hancock, The Roots, Medeski, Martin and Wood, Talvin Singh and Burning Spear to name just a few.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
